
KFC打字机【功能板】APM32主控键盘
简介
项目可兼容使用用其他淘宝店的成品开发板或我自己设计的主控板 本设计只支持两种排针顺序的主控板(xxx32F103系列主控) 如果要用其他主控板记得先检查排针接口顺序和主控芯片类型
简介:项目可兼容使用用其他淘宝店的成品开发板或我自己设计的主控板 本设计只支持两种排针顺序的主控板(xxx32F103系列主控) 如果要用其他主控板记得先检查排针接口顺序和主控芯片类型开源协议
:CC BY-NC-SA 4.0
描述
【KFC打字机】项目,
【QMK方案+主控板分离的模块化设计】
【大板--主控板--模块小板多层堆叠】
项目提供多种模块的板子与现成的固件。
可以自己打样制作,照抄现有设计和固件。
可以按排针的接口顺序,去创建自己的硬件设计,使用现成固件,免得自己写固件。
也可以当一个案例参考,自己画原理图,编写固件。
【主页另一个工程有键盘常用元件和最小系统可以用】
电容电阻基本都是0805封装的,基本都是立创基础库,按BOM料号搜索可直接优信淘宝店购买。
仅用于STM/APM32系统原理图的学习参考,以及新手小白试做小玩具,请勿商用。
项目长期开源,不定期更新。

1.【可兼容使用用其他淘宝店的成品开发板或我自己设计的主控板】
本设计只支持两种排针顺序的主控板(xxx32F103系列主控)
如果要用其他主控板记得先检查排针接口顺序和主控芯片类型
我的成品开发板是在淘宝鹿小班家买的,排针间距600mil,有好几款可以选,
这种普通开发板用排针连接可叠加三层,掰断排针可叠加更多。
用我自己设计的带螺丝柱的主控板或FPC小板可以无限堆叠。
我的主控板采用APM32F103CBT6主控,排针间距800MIL,带螺丝孔,
暂时未开源,等优化好会放到另一个工程里开源的。
2.【简单的自定义硬件,小白可以轻松上手】
项目提供几个基础的板子,抛砖引玉。
有6键、9键的按键板,旋钮微动模块,电磁阀模块,FPC小板等。
你可以参照已有的板子、自己设计、创建自己的新板子,
换样式、加东西、搞各种小配列、设计各种奇奇怪怪的小模块。
直接使用现有的元件,自己摆放元件做布局。
由于主控分离的设计,简单到可以直接用自动布线,图个省事。
【我主页另一个工程有键盘常用元件和最小系统可以用】
(创建新板子时需要复制好排针的位置和接口顺序)
(自定义的内容不可超过固件包括的范围,这样才能直接用附带的固件!)
(如果超出了固件所包括的内容或修改了接口顺序,要自己修改编译固件哦!)
3.【一套固件走天下】
项目附带QMK方案的源代码、编译好的bin格式固件,
还有STM32/APM32芯片可用的BootLoader文件、芯片手册以及支持VIA的json文件。
附带的代码和固件:最大支持30个按键,30个RGB轴灯,15个单色底灯,
带两个旋钮,带电磁阀和蜂鸣器,默认布局如下:
超过固件附带内容的需要自己编写固件!
没有装QMK环境的可以直接用编译好的固件,
如果需要做其他32xx主控键盘或者自己开发新模块的也可以参考我的源代码修改。

3.【小白怎么玩】
1.领取立创优惠券,白嫖打板
(开源的几个板子都是能白嫖的大小)
2.焊接,组装硬件
(电容电阻基本都是0805封装的,立创基础库,方便花钱SMT贴片或者自己焊接)
(可直接按BOM单的料号搜索,在优信淘宝店购买。主控板有提供淘宝链接可自行选购)
3.烧录BL
(烧录器推荐淘宝店创芯工坊的PowerWriter-link,9.9包邮,售后服务到位)
4.用toolbox软件烧录.bin固件,把json文件传到VIA里
5.外壳随便你怎么整,没有都行
【最后】
本项目目前处于验证阶段,已验证的板子会打上标记号,
未验证的板子请自己检查好、谨慎使用。
在下管杀不管埋哦,有错误的可以评论区提醒我修改
如果你有了自己的设计要开源(兼容这个的),欢迎在评论区贴工程链接
欢迎加入肯德基豪华午餐!
2024/1/19更新:
1.上传了一份外壳图纸,
2.固件更新,现在有VIA和Vial两种固件可选
本项目基于CC-BY-NC-SA 4.0协议开源,
转载时需要给出适当的署名(须包含本项目链接),同时标明是否对原有所修改。
不得将本作品用于任何商业用途。
若您修改、转变或更改本作品,仅在遵守与本作品相同的许可条款下,您才能散布由本作品产生的派生作品。
设计图
未生成预览图,请在编辑器重新保存一次BOM
暂无BOM
克隆工程

评论